Racegoers headed to Flemington Racecourse on Thursday (November 8) in Melbourne, Australia, for Oaks Day – also known as Ladies Day.

It’s currently Spring in Australia, and it would appear that pink was the order of the day.

Elyse Taylor: The Myer ambassador wore a signature, well-tailored Alex Perry dress with a statement pleated sleeve giving the look so much life.

Kate Waterhouse: The socialite clearly got the pink memo opting for a Dolce & Gabbana ruched dress, matching bag and Chaumet jewels, but the leopard print pumps are a head scratcher here.

Oaks Day

Megan Gale: The model was a vision in bold florals that embolden her drop-waist Maticevski frock. All black accessories including a Ferragamo bag and Kurt Geiger pumps completed her look, with a gold headpiece by Ford Millinery which didn’t quite work for me. The classic style of the dress felt like it needed a classic head-piece.

Montana Cox: The model didn’t get the pink or floral memo, opting to march to the beat of her own drum in this intricate Zimmermann Spring 2019 piece. On this occasion the gold head-piece worked in perfect harmony with her look which she styled with a Chloe bag and gold Stuart Weitzman sandals.

Jennifer Hawkins: Making her last official appearance as a Myer ambassador, she bowed out of her duties looking gorgeous wearing a beautiful Alex Perry floral dress and delightful hot pink suede Aquazzura pumps.
